Before you upscale it is crucial to get the best rip possible. To my knowledge the best ripping and deinterlacing process is called QTGMC.

After that, experiment with AI upscalers. But the best Upscalers will only get so far when the initial rip isnt as best as possible.

Oftentimes anything copyrighted like warez, music and movies are called 'linux isos' to hide the fact that you are doing something shady.

Like: "I got a NAS with 20TB of Linux Isos to enjoy."

Install Android Studio on your PC and create a new empty app. Plug in your mobile and deploy that app. Now select that app as the second one for the lower half. It should be all black, if its all white, change the background color.

Or look if there is an all black app in the store, probably a screen tester app.

Samsung has this feature build in and its called 'Extra dim' or similar. Its a quick setting one can get when customizing the tiles.

I used to use third party apps too, but it was annoying that you couldnt grant permissions or install new apps without deactivating the dimming app since it was a security risk to have an app which draws over other apps.

Use docker. There are docker images which have vpns and torrent clients inside. The torrent client only gets connected to the internet when a vpn connection is established.
